Ingredients

Experience a delightful medley of grilled chicken, fresh veggies, and savory feta over fluffy basmati rice. Perfect for lunch or dinner, it’s a nourishing bowl bursting with zest!

For the Chicken Marinade

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ste

For the Rice

  • 1 cup basmati rice
  • 2 cups chicken broth

For Toppings

  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1/2 cucumber, diced
  • 1/4 cup red on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up Kalamata olives, pitted and sliced
  • 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
  • Lemon wedges, for serving

How to Make Mediterranean Chicken and Rice Bowl

Step 1: Prepare the Marinade

In a medium bowl, mix together olive oil, lemon juice, oregano,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Make sure all ingredients are well combined.

Step 2: Marinate the Chicken

Add the chicken breasts to the bowl with marinade. Ensure they are well coated.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.

Step 3: Cook the Rice

In a saucepan, add the basmati rice along with chicken broth. Bring this mixture to a boil. Once boiling, reduce heat to low. Cover the saucepan and let it cook for about 15 minutes or until rice is tender and most of the broth is absorbed.

Step 4: Grill the Chicken

While the rice is cooking, heat your grill pan over medium-high heat. Remove the marinated chicken from the fridge. Grill each breast for 6-7 minutes on each side or until fully cooked through (juices should run clear).

Step 5: Slice the Chicken

Once cooked thoroughly, remove from grill pan. Allow resting for 5 minutes before slicing into thin strips.

Step 6: Assemble Your Bowl

In a large serving bowl, layer cooked rice at the bottom. Add sliced grilled chicken on top followed by cherry tomatoes, diced cucumber, red onion slices, olives, and crumbled feta cheese.

Step 7: Garnish and Serve

Top your Mediterranean Chicken and Rice Bowl with chopped parsley. Serve with lemon wedges on the side to enhance flavor further.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Even the best recipes can falter without attention to detail. Here are some common mistakes to avoid when making a Mediterranean Chicken and Rice Bowl.

  • Skipping the marinade: Neglecting to marinate the chicken can lead to bland flavor. Allow the chicken to soak in the marinade for at least 30 minutes for maximum taste.
  • Overcooking the rice: Cooking rice too long can make it mushy. Follow package instructions closely, and check for tenderness at the minimum cooking time.
  • Ignoring ingredient freshness: Using stale or old vegetables will diminish taste and texture. Always choose fresh produce for the best results in your Mediterranean Chicken and Rice Bowl.
  • Cutting chicken too soon: Slicing grilled chicken right away can cause juices to run out, leading to dry meat. Let it rest for at least 5 minutes before cutting.
  • Forgetting about toppings: Skipping toppings like feta and olives can leave your dish lacking in flavor. Don’t forget these essential elements that add zest and depth.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container.
  • Keep in the fridge for up to 3 days.

Freezing Mediterranean Chicken and Rice Bowl

  • Use freezer-safe containers for storage.
  • Can be frozen for up to 2 months.

Reheating Mediterranean Chicken and Rice Bowl

  •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C), cover with foil, and heat for about 20 minutes.
  • Microwave: Heat in short intervals, stirring occasionally until heated through.
  • Stovetop: Warm over medium heat in a skillet, adding a splash of water or broth if needed.
